16 lessons//8 Weeks
Week 1Lesson 1Introduction to Spanish• Welcome and Icebreaker: Learning to introduce yourself • The Spanish Alphabet: Learning the alphabet through song • Activity: Alphabet gameLesson 2Numbers 1-20• Introduction to Numbers: Counting and number recognition • Activity: Number matching games and counting exercisesWeek 2Lesson 3Numbers 21-100• Advanced Counting: Learning tens and higher numbers • Activity: Number puzzles and interactive counting gamesLesson 4Days of the Week• Days of the Week: Learning and practicing with a catchy song • Activity: Calendar creation and other interactive gamesWeek 3Lesson 5Months of the Year• Months of the Year: Introduction through song • Activity: Create a monthly planner in SpanishLesson 6Weather• Weather Conditions: Basic weather terms and phrases • Activity: Create a weather collageWeek 4Lesson 7Seasons• Seasons of the Year: Vocabulary and seasonal activities • Activity: Season collage and matching gamesLesson 8Review day• Review Session: Alphabet, numbers, days, months, weather, and seasons • Activity: Interactive quiz games and team challenges with Kahoot!Week 5Lesson 9Talking About Yourself• Personal Introductions: Basic phrases to talk about your name, age, and characteristics • Activity: Create a personal profile posterLesson 10Family• Family Members: Vocabulary and simple sentences about family members • Activity: Interactive Family tree activityWeek 6Lesson 11Friends and Social Interaction• Talking About Friends: Practice describing your friends and family with the previous vocabulary. • Activity: Writing activity about a family member.Lesson 12Review day• Review Session: Personal introductions, family, and friends • Activity: Kahoot!Week 7Lesson 13Ordering Food• Food Vocabulary: Common foods and drinks in Spanish • Activity: Menu creation and food matching gamesLesson 14Restaurant Role-Play• Ordering Food: Role-playing ordering food in a restaurant • Activity: Mini-restaurant role-playWeek 8Lesson 15Cultural Exploration• Spanish-Speaking Countries: Introduction to various cultures and traditions • Activity: Cultural crafts and musicLesson 16Final Review and Celebration• Review Session: Comprehensive review of all topics • Activity: Fun games
This class is taught in Spanish.
- Students will be able to properly use the verbs- ser, tener, and hacer with the correct subject/ verb agreement.
- Students will be able to count to 100.
- Students will recite the days of the week, months of the year, and the seasons.
- Students will be able to talk about the weather.
- Students will be about to talk about themselves and others.
- Students will be able to order food in a restaurant.
